Falcons Face Mounting Pressure

FLOWERY BRANCH, Ga. – As the Atlanta Falcons prepare for Week 10, they find themselves in a precarious position. With a record of 3-5, the team is reeling from three consecutive losses, watching their playoff aspirations dwindle with each passing game. Their next challenge? A transatlantic journey to Berlin to face off against the Indianapolis Colts, who currently hold the title of the NFL’s top-rated team.

When a team is backed into a corner, the strategy often revolves around leaning on its star players. The Falcons have a few key figures to rely on, but one standout who has proven his mettle recently is Drake London.

London’s Stellar Performance Against the Patriots

After sitting out the previous week due to a hip injury, London returned with a vengeance in the Falcons’ matchup against the New England Patriots in Week 9. The young receiver showcased his skills by amassing over half of quarterback Michael Penix Jr.’s total passing yards, reeling in 118 receiving yards. He was instrumental in securing eight receptions, which accounted for a third of Penix’s completions, and he found the end zone three times.

Raheem Morris, the Falcons’ head coach, highlighted London’s effort, describing it as “uncommon.” Penix echoed the sentiment, noting, “That’s just him.” London’s performance featured critical fourth-down conversions and must-have touchdowns, showcasing his ability to rise to the occasion against a formidable Patriots defense, including one of the league’s premier cornerbacks, Christian Gonzalez.
